PER CURIAM.

The petition for belated appeal is granted. A copy of this opinion shall be filed

with the trial court and be treated as the notice of appeal from the August 31, 2017,

judgment and sentence rendered in Case No. 2012-CF-004925 in the Circuit Court in

and for Orange County, Florida. See Fla. R. App. P. 9.141(c)(6)(D).

PETITION GRANTED.

ORFINGER, HARRIS and GROSSHANS, JJ., concur.
